| Chemical Name | Butylated Hydroxyanisole |
| Abbreviation | BHA |
| Cas Number | 25013-16-5 |
| Molecular Formula | C11H16O2 |
| Molecular Weight | 180.25 g/mol |
| Appearance | White or yellowish waxy solid |
| Solubility | Soluble in alcohol, fat, and oils; insoluble in water |
| Melting Point | 48–63 °C |
| Boiling Point | 264 °C |
| Odor | Faint aromatic odor |
| Stability | Stable under recommended storage conditions |
| Usage | Antioxidant in foods, cosmetics, and pharmaceuticals |

| Storage | Butylated Hydroxyanisole (BHA) should be stored in a tightly closed container, protected from light, heat, and moisture. Store at room temperature in a cool, dry, well-ventilated area, away from incompatible substances such as strong oxidizers. Ensure proper labeling and keep away from sources of ignition. Follow all safety guidelines to prevent contamination and degradation of the compound. |
| Shipping | Butylated Hydroxyanisole (BHA) should be shipped in tightly sealed containers, protected from moisture and light. It is classified as a non-hazardous material under most transport regulations. During shipping, it must be kept away from strong oxidizing agents. Standard safety procedures and labeling must be followed to ensure proper handling and delivery. |
